The ParentZone Pods identify common issues parents bring to our parenting groups and explores these in detail. We not only discuss the issues and concerns parents bring, but also offer strategies parents can try in these situations. These podcasts recognise that parenting is the toughest and most important job there is! Children don’t come with a manual, and sometimes parents seek guidance in ways to support their children and improve the family unit as a whole. The hosts Anita Weber and Laurie-Lee Arrowsmith (Season 1) and Michelle Brown (Season 2) are Parent Group Facilitators working at ParentZone. They work on a daily basis with families in groups supporting them with a variety of parenting issues and concerns.
